How to prepare for a job interview at TeacherActive Limited

✨Know Your Curriculum

Make sure you’re familiar with the schemes of learning for both KS3 and KS4. Brush up on the latest GCSE requirements and be ready to discuss how you would implement these in your teaching. This shows that you’re not just a teacher, but a proactive educator who is invested in student success.

✨Showcase Your Classroom Management Skills

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ed a classroom in the past. Think about specific strategies you’ve used to engage students and maintain discipline. Being able to articulate your approach will demonstrate your capability to create a positive learning environment.

✨Engage with the School's Values

Research the school’s ethos and values before the interview. Be ready to discuss how your teaching philosophy aligns with their mission to promote student engagement and personal growth. This connection can set you apart as a candidate who truly fits into their community.

✨Prepare Questions for Them

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about the school's culture, support for teachers, and opportunities for professional development.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the school is the right fit for you.
